About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Provide on-going field support and will focus on growing the market awareness for TAVI and related disease states, including launching new products
  • Work closely with the sales team and be responsible for aspects of US strategy implementation including digital strategy and channel execution
  • Measure success against sales and margin expectations, sales force competency/knowledge level and development of marketing programs
  • Maintain in-depth knowledge of US competitor products and strategies, market trends and dynamics, market/franchise critical success factors, and customer needs
  • Contribute to annual marketing plans/strategies including market analysis, customer segmentation and targeting, product positioning, competitive assessments, and SWOT situation assessment
  • Manage field device demo needs, tracking sales & patient resource utilization, and working with communications manager to manage promotional collateral
  • Take a leadership role on project teams to work closely with the project manager to drive accountability and team achievement of goals and milestones
  • Manage creative agencies to plan, develop, and execute new US materials
  • Partner with regulatory colleagues in the review and negotiation of materials to ensure competitiveness, accuracy, and compliance
  • Drive to deliver Sales, Margin, and key performance metrics for TAVR products
  • Be responsive and able to directly address questions and requests of senior management

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Prior marketing experience within medical device or healthcare industry
  • Bachelor’s Degree with 6+ years related marketing or product management experience, preferably in TAVI/TAVR
  • MBA with 4+ years of related experience also considered
  • Relevant downstream marketing experience
  • Ability to travel 30% of the time
  • Able to understand technical and scientific information
  • Able to handle a fast-paced working environment
  • Substantial financial skills, market analysis and advanced communication skills
  • Strong analytical skills as well as written and oral communication skills
